Summary
Enables several functions, including DNA-binding transcription activator activity, RNA polymerase II-specific; collagen binding activity; and identical protein binding activity. Involved in several processes, including cell surface receptor signaling pathway; heart development; and positive regulation of protein modification process. Acts upstream of or within several processes, including animal organ development; positive regulation of gonadotropin secretion; and regulation of transcription, DNA-templated. Located in cytoplasm and nucleus. Part of RNA polymerase II transcription regulator complex. Is expressed in several structures, including central nervous system; early conceptus; genitourinary system; immune system; and respiratory system. Used to study juvenile polyposis syndrome and osteogenesis imperfecta. Human ortholog(s) of this gene implicated in several diseases, including female reproductive organ cancer (multiple); hereditary hemorrhagic telangiectasia; juvenile polyposis syndrome; juvenile polyposis-hereditary hemorrhagic telangiectasia syndrome; and seminoma. Orthologous to human SMAD4 (SMAD family member 4). [provided by Alliance of Genome Resources, Apr 2022]
